Blue Pearl Granite is a luxurious natural stone characterised by stunning blue, silver, and black tones with an iridescent shimmer. Quarried in Norway, it is prized for its durability and beauty.
Widely used for kitchen countertops, flooring, and wall cladding, it is a common choice for residential and commercial applications. Properties and Composition of Blue Pearl Granite
Properties
- Density: 2680 – 2770 kg/m³, which shows high strength.
- Compressive Strength: 166 – 227 MPa, which enables it to resist pressure and wear.
- Flexural Strength: 12.0 – 14.5 MPa flexural strength for bending resistance.
- Hardness as per Mohs Scale: 6 – 6.5, providing great scratch resistance.
- Porosity: Low porosity, minimising water absorption and staining.
- Heat Resistance: Can withstand high temperatures without discolouration.
Composition
- Feldspar (Anorthoclase): Makes up the bulk of composition (80 – 85%), giving it its characteristic iridescent blue shimmer.
- Quartz: Provides added strength and scratch resistance.
- Accessory Minerals: Biotite (mica), Pyroxene, and Amphibole give contrast, structural integrity, and colour variations.
Advantages of Using Blue Pearl Granite in Construction
Exceptional Durability
It is also a good choice for high-traffic surfaces, such as countertops and flooring, as blue pearl granite is highly durable, scratch-resistant, and heat-resistant. The low porosity of Blue Pearl Granite does not absorb water and does not stain easily, extending its performance for years ahead.
Stunning Aesthetic Appeal
Its dark, bluish-grey base with a speck of blue sheen crystals makes any surrounding look absolutely sophisticated. Its iridescent sheen lends itself to a range of modern and traditional fashions, complementing the overall design of any interior.
Versatile Applications
Blue Pearl Granite Stone is used for kitchen worktops, bath vanities, flooring, wall covering, stairs, and exterior. Its versatility allows for it to be used in many different types of construction and design projects.
Weather Resistance
This granite is also resistant to frost and dimensional, can be used in interiors and exteriors, and is appropriate for every environment.
Longevity
Blue Pearl Granite has a high compressive strength, meaning that it can withstand high weight and heavy wear without cracking or chipping over time, keeping its appearance flawless for years to come.

Blue Pearl Granite Finishes & Textures
Polished
Blue Pearl Granite with a polished finish is characterised by a high-gloss surface, which accentuates its natural hues and glimmering blue and silver crystals. Perfect for countertops and decorative elements, it reflects light beautifully.
Honed
Honed finish is usually the preferred finish for its matte appearance, and this makes the stone softer while keeping the stone’s durability. Many people also use this type to achieve a non-reflective surface in flooring or walling applications.
Leathered
This textured finish looks naturalistic and is fingerprint and smear-resistant. This makes it ideal for kitchen counters and other high-traffic areas.
Brushed
A brushed finish provides a slightly textured surface. It enhances the stone’s natural beauty and offers slip resistance, making it ideal for outdoor applications and flooring.
Flamed
The flamed finish gives a rough texture, perfect for outdoor areas like patios and pathways. It is resilient, slip-resistant, and able to withstand heavy wear.
Lapatura
Combining polished and honed characteristics, the lapatura finish offers a soft sheen with a unique visual effect, often used in luxury applications to add depth and character.
Blue Pearl Granite Price & Cost Factors
Price Range
Domestic Blue Pearl Granite in India typically costs between Rs. 50 and Rs. 80 per square foot, varying based on supplier and product features. Imported Blue Pearl Granite, sourced from Norway, generally ranges from Rs. 450 to Rs. 650 per square foot, reflecting its unique characteristics and higher quality.
Cost Factors
- Quality: The slabs with premium quality or brighter colours are costlier.
- Finish: The type of finish (polished, honed, leathered, etc.) affects cost, with polished finishes being more expensive.
- Thickness: Price rises with thicker slabs (20 mm vs. 30 mm).
- Supplier Location Prices: These depend on regional market conditions and transportation costs.
- MOQ & Customization: Bulk orders and custom sizes may result in additional costs.

How to Care for & Clean Blue Pearl Granite
1. Daily Cleaning
Dust off loose dirt with a soft microfiber cloth or vacuum using a brush attachment. Wash with warm water and a pH-balanced cleaner (you want to avoid strong chemicals like vinegar or bleach). Gently wipe the surface using a soft, non-abrasive cloth or sponge.
2. Stain Removal
For stubborn stains, rub in a paste of baking soda and water, allow to sit for some hours, then rinse out. Add in specialised cleaners for oil or water-based stains as necessary.
3. Sealing
Seal Blue Pearl Granite during installation and reapply every 3–5 years to protect against moisture and stains.
4. Additional Tips
Avoid harsh chemicals and clean spills immediately. Use trivets under hot items and coasters to protect the surface. Buff after cleaning to maintain shine.
